Description
PURPOSE: The Albuquerque Area Indian Health Service (AAIHS), Santa Fe Indian Health Center (SFIHC), and Satellite Clinics have a requirement for annual software maintenance, licensing, and technical support for D3-MMP patient identification system used with thermal label and wristband printers. Description of Services: The Albuquerque Area Indian Health Service (AAIHS) requires a contractor to provide annual software maintenance, licensing, technical support, and training for the existing D3-MMP patient identification system utilized at the Santa Fe Indian Health Center, San Felipe Health Clinic, Santa Clara Health Clinic, and Cochiti Health Clinic. The requirement consists of a one-year base period and four one-year option periods. Services shall support the existing D3-MMP system used with GX430t thermal transfer printers, thermal wristband printers, and label printers located throughout the clinics. The printers are used to produce patient chart labels, specimen vial labels, and patient wristbands. The contractor shall provide: Remote diagnostics and troubleshooting support via VPN access; Operating system security patches; Software updates and annual licensing; Hardware repair/replacement (RMAs) as required; Customer support for product ordering and coordination; and Initial operator training for new technology installations and annual refresher training, as needed. HOW TO RESPOND: This is a sources sought notice under the authority of the Buy Indian Act. The Indian Health Service (IHS) is attempting to locate qualified and eligible Small Business Indian Firms, �Native American Indian Owned and Operated businesses,� that can provide services/supplies to the Indian Health Service. This is a request for information only, this is not a solicitation. Responses to this notice are not considered offers and cannot be accepted by the Government to form a binding contract. Any information submitted by respondents to this notice is strictly voluntary with no obligation or incurred cost by the government.
